I've read good things about these and i recently acquired a pair. I've got to say i really don't like them, so I am trying to figure out if it is my pair or the model. there doesn't seem to be any fullness to the sound, very top-heavy. maybe they need a re-cable? maybe bad drivers? i am pretty sure i am getting a decent seal and would be willing to rule out pads for now, although they are worn out. anyways anyone who has a pair could you describe why you like them and what music i should listen to to appreciate these. I would like to keep them but right now I really can't see why I would.

There are a few who'll chime in, that swear by these. But I'm on you're side, I have the original old version, and while they sound good, don't sound any better than my k140's 600ohm. IMO of course.
They sound thin, and while other seem to disagree, sibilant. They are detailed, and I seem to like acoustics on them though, but been listening to my DT990's mostly these days.

They aren't killer cans when it comes to getting the high end sound like the HD580 can do, but then the Monitor 10 cost about 20-40 euros now. I really like their sound, but it's not for all my music. Also, they are closed and isolate really really well which is sometimes an advantage. (No, I don't find them sibilant. But they are old, so there could very well also be individual variations between different cans.)

Ear pads can make a big difference, by the way.
